The [3] ER Immerse Program will prepare veterinarians for a sustainable and satisfying career in emergency medicine. Built from the ground up to be different than traditional rotating internship programs, the ERi program has been developed around a curriculum of core competencies essential for an emergency veterinarian. In addition to providing training around clinical knowledge and skills, the program also includes a focus on client and team member communication, professional skills, and life/work integration. The ER Immerse program utilizes a hybrid training approach incorporating simulation-based didactic components into authentic training experiences with live patients. The curriculum is designed using an evidence-based strategy identifying competencies and skills deemed essential for a successful career as an emergency clinician. From early entry all the way to AVMA recognized board-certification, the ER Immerse training tracks provide the ultimate career paths for veterinarians with a passion for emergency medicine - at any stage of their career. Rolling admission dates means flexibility to choose when you want to start this fulfilling journey. Come and be part of a 16,000 square foot state-of-the-art hospital at Arizona Veterinary Emergency & Critical Care Center located in beautiful Peoria, AZ. Our Emergency & Critical Care hospital offers three sister sites and serves the fast-growing Peoria, Glendale, Goodyear, and Buckeye areas of Northwest Phoenix. AVECCC hospitals have created a reputation for their market-leading emergency care, strong culture and established internship program and residency programs. We also pride ourselves in providing you with a well-staffed, highly skilled technical support team. Our DVM team is supported in person or on-call by a team of board-certified critical care specialists available 24/7/365 days a year. At Peoria you will have access to and consistent availability of specialty services and consultation to in-house access to board certified surgeons, cardiologists, dentists, radiologists, and internal medicine specialists.
